Latest revision as of 18:45, 21 October 2022
| Meteoric Crash | ||
| ||
| Game Version | 1.7.4 | |
|---|---|---|
| Category Type | Prodigies | |
| Category | Willpower | |
| Requirements | Willpower 50 A meteor has crashed, from any of the following:
The player doesn't need to actually see it happen. Needs verification | |
| Use Mode | Passive | |
| Cost | - | |
| Range | - | |
| Cooldown | 15 | |
| Travel Speed | - | |
| Use Speed | - | |
| Description | When casting damaging spells or mind attacks, the release of your willpower can call forth a meteor to crash down near your foes. The meteor deals (50 + 5 * (Spellpower or Mindpower)) damage in radius 2 (split evenly between fire and physical damage) and stuns enemies for 3 turns. Additionally, your fire damage bonus and resistance penetration is set to your current highest damage bonus and resistance penetration. This applies to all fire damage you deal. | |
